Cell therapies are already changing what’s possible for patients, including people facing cancers and other diseases that once had few options. The next challenge is access. To help more patients, manufacturing has to become more reliable, more repeatable, and easier to scale. At Cellular Origins, we’re building that shift, and as an Integration Engineer you’ll be one of the people who makes it real, bringing complex subsystems together until the whole platform behaves as one.

Cellular Origins is enabling scalable, cost-effective and efficient manufacture of cell and gene therapies. Our robotic automation approach is designed to reduce hands-on labour, remove avoidable human error, and increase consistency, so more therapies can be made with confidence, at greater scale.
